ISLAMABAD: The United States and Iran have reached an agreement to end the war and open the Strait of Hormuz, offering relief to the global economy more than three months since…

The agreement marks one of the biggest diplomatic developments since the U.S. launched strikes in February.

It reopens Hormuz and starts a 60-day clock for nuclear talks.

Details of the deal were not immediately available. Key mediator Pakistan said the signing will be Friday in Switzerland.
